www.sharemylesson.com
You can
share and download documents for free after registering through google account
or Facebook. (It is a very easy and simple process.) It also provides links and
documents for professional development. You can either use the lesson plans as
they are or just get some ideas for activities and games to make your class
less boring and more interactive.

www.pinterest.com

It provides all kinds of ideas and
creative activities that are posted by other people all around the wrold and
links to other websites. You can save the link (pin it) and
also you can create boards according to different topics to organize your
ideas. It helps teachers to be creative in
creating their lessons and gives ideas for projects and visual material. (For
more information about this website visit the digital learning page where I
explain more in details about how to use this website).
